Description: Parallel computing system (rsh version)
 MPICH is a robust and flexible implementation of the MPI (Message
 Passing Interface).  MPI is often used with parallel or distributed
 computing projects.  MPICH is a multi-platform, configurable
 system (development, execution, libraries, etc) for MPI.  It can
 acheive parallelism using networked machines or using mulitasking on a
 single machine.
 .
 This version is compiled for use with rsh.
